After 9 jurors were seated by 5:30pm Tuesday, the most damning testimony against the former assistant football coach could come from Sandusky himself.
ABC News first reported Sandusky allegedly wrote "creepy" love letters to his victims and those letters will be read into testimony.
According to numerous sources, the letters were written by Sandusky to Victim 4, who is expected to be the first witness to testify when the trial begins Monday.
Ben Andreozzi, the victim's attorney wouldn't give specifics about what's in the letters, but sources told the network that one that was written in the third person includes a lewd title and is a love story between a boy and a man.
Published reports say Andreozzi's client has evidence to support his allegations and that there's other evidence that has not been released to the public yet that Andreozzi thinks will resonate with the jury.
